At the time of the sale it had 3,950 flight hours, according to helis.com, averaging out to 188 hours a year — a light workload for a VIP helicopter. The fatal accident rate for helicopters in the U.S. was 0.82 per 100,000 flight hours in 2019, according to the U.S. Helicopter Safety Team, with 24 accidents claiming 55 lives. Helicopter Safety Team. Private use accounted for 3% of all flight hours in that period but 22% of fatal accidents.
